    I bought Parrot Pro last year when it first came out for the Z10. It love it, and it's a go-to app for me (I record lots of interviews and meetings, and the quality is easily good enough for broadcast).

    I got a Passport a few days after release, and all my apps were updated. However, I noticed that, while Parrot installed, it was the free download version. I went into the app to do the "upgrade" and logged into App World (as expected). However, I was returned an error (AW30222i) that said "You have purchased this item already, and won't be charged to download it again.

    Bought it...but it won't upgrade. Any ideas? Anyone? I've had no response from the developer after several help requests, and no response from the official BB forums.

    Problem Solved: I uninstalled Parrot, removed it from the "available" list in BBW. Shut down the phone. Restarted. Downloaded a fresh copy of Parrot. Opened it, and waited 20 seconds. Spontaneously, and on its own, the app upgraded itself to Pro. So...by literally doing nothing, the problem sorts itself out.

    If you have Parrot version 2.3.1, open the app, go to "More" in the bottom right, then tap "Settings". In the Settings screen, find the "Check Pro Status" button and tap it to manually check for your upgrade.

    For users on previous version of Parrot, simply restart your device, ensure you have internet access, then open Parrot and wait for 10-20 seconds.
